You're investing in loans that fund Irish property development and bridging projects. Each investment is a loan to a vetted borrower, secured against property, and you earn interest on the amount you lend.
Property Bridges connects investors with property developers seeking finance. We assess and list each opportunity, and you choose which loans to fund from as little as €500. As the borrower repays, you receive your capital plus interest.
Yes. Your investment is a loan secured against property. If the borrower defaults, Property Bridges can enforce the security — including taking possession of or selling the property — to recover the amounts owed to investors.
No investment is guaranteed. Loans are secured against property, which significantly reduces risk, but your capital is at risk and returns are not guaranteed.
Most opportunities are short-to-medium term loans (typically 6–24 months) funding residential development, refurbishment, or bridging finance across Ireland.
Each project undergoes credit assessment, independent valuation, and legal due diligence, and must be approved by our credit committee before it is listed for funding.
Yes. As with any investment, your capital is at risk. The main risks are borrower default and delays in repayment. Security over property and our due-diligence process are designed to mitigate these risks.
Peer-to-peer (P2P) lending lets individuals lend directly to borrowers through an online platform and earn interest in return, without a traditional bank acting as the intermediary.
You can start from €500, and there is no upper limit. You decide how much to allocate to each loan.
There are no fees to register or to invest. Property Bridges is paid by the borrower, not by the investor.
Interest is paid to your e-wallet according to each loan's repayment schedule — typically monthly, quarterly, or on redemption, depending on the loan.
Your e-wallet is a secure account, provided by our regulated payments partner Mangopay, that holds your funds, interest, and repayments ready to invest or withdraw.
Funds held in your e-wallet do not earn interest. They earn returns only once allocated to a live loan.
Auto Invest automatically allocates your available funds across new loans that match your chosen criteria, so you stay invested without manually selecting each loan.
No. Interest is paid gross. You are responsible for declaring and paying any tax due on your returns based on your personal circumstances.

If a loan is redeemed early, your capital and any interest due are returned to your e-wallet, ready to reinvest or withdraw.
Loans are secured by a legal charge over the borrower's property, giving investors a claim over that asset if the loan is not repaid.
A 1st legal charge ranks first for repayment from the property's proceeds; a 2nd legal charge ranks after the first. A first charge offers stronger security.
We work with the borrower to recover the amount due. If necessary, we enforce the security over the property — including sale or possession — to repay investors.
We carry out credit assessment, identity and background checks, independent valuations, and legal due diligence before approving any loan.
